Dr. Joseph Potaczek is a native Chicagoan. He came to psychology after a previous executive management career and then completed his Psy.D. (doctor of psychology) at Adler University in Chicago. His perspective and experience reaches out to supporting the needs of individuals undergoing various concerns, stressors and transitions.
Dr. Potaczek believes that individuals are able to make positive and meaningful changes in their lives.
